Flexible power supply The Drager X-am 5000 can be used with the standard alkaline batteries. In addition, it can be fitted with a T4 battery that can be charged while still inside the instrument. The optional Save Energy Mode makes it possible to increase the operating time of the Drager X-am 5000 to more than 40 hours. This is done by selecting a measurement interval of either one second (the standard), 10 or 20 seconds for the CatEx sensor. Robust and watertight The Drager X-am 5000 is water and dust resistant, according to IP67 standards. The detector remains fully functional and ready for use, even after being dropped into water. The integrated rubber protection and shockproof sensors provide additional resistance to impact and vibration. Moreover, the Drager X-am 5000 is resistant to electromagnetic interference. These warnings contain signal words to alert you to the degree of hazard you may encounter. These signal words and corresponding hazards are as follows: DANGER Indicates an immediate hazardous situation which, if not avoided, could result in death or serious injury. WARNING Indicates a potential hazardous situation which, if not avoided, could result in death or serious injury. CAUTION Indicates a potential hazardous situation which, if not avoided, could result in injury or damage to property. Can also be used to warn against any wanton actions. NOTICE Additional information on the use of the device. Intended Use Portable gas detection instrument for the continuous monitoring of the concentration of several gases in the ambient air within the working area and in explosion-hazard areas. The display of the CatEx sensor may be incorrect for measurements in a low-oxygen atmosphere ( 21 vol. % O 2 ), the electrical operational safety cannot be guaranteed; switch off device or remove from the working area. During operation During operation, the measured values for every measured gas are displayed. Excess concentrations of flammable materials can lead to a lack of oxygen. In the event of an alarm, the corresponding displays, including the visual, audible and vibration alarms, are activated see Identifying Alarms on page 19. If the measuring range is exceeded significantly on the CatEx channel (very high concentration of flammable materials), a blocking alarm is triggered. This CatEx blocking alarm can be acknowledged manually by switching the device off and back on again in fresh air. In configuration setting CH 4 with measuring range 100 vol. %, no blocking alarm is triggered as the heat conductance measurement principle is used. CAUTION The measuring range 0 to 100 vol. % CH4 is not suitable for monitoring explosive mixtures in the measuring range from 0 to 100%LEL. It is absolutely necessary to flush the extension hose to eliminate or minimize the effects which may interfere with measurements when using a sampling hose or a probe, e.g., memory effects, dead volume. The flushing phase depends on various factors, e.g., type and concentration of the gas or vapor to be measured, material, length, diameter, and age of the sampling hose or probe. Generally, when using a sampling hose (new, dry, clean), a typical flushing time of approx. 3 seconds is required for each meter. This flushing time applies in addition to the sensor response time (see the Instructions for Use of the gas measuring device used).
